DTC P0197, P0198; Engine Oil Temperature Sensor Low [08/2014 - 08/2016]: Procedure

  1. READ VALUE USING TECHSTREAM (ENGINE OIL TEMPERATURE SENSOR) 
    1. Connect the Techstream to the DLC3.
    2. Start the engine and warm it up.
    3. Turn the Techstream on.
    4. Enter the following menus: Powertrain / Engine and ECT / Data List / Engine Control / Engine Oil Temperature Sensor.

      Powertrain > Engine and ECT > Data List 

      Tester Display
      Engine Oil Temperature Sensor
    5. Read the value displayed on the Techstream.

      Standard value

      Between 80 and 110°C (176 and 230°F) with warm engine and engine idling

      Result

      Result Proceed to
      -40°C (-40°F) A
      Higher than 166°C (331°F) B
      Between 80 and 110°C (176 and 230°F) C

      HINT: 

      • If there is an open circuit, the Techstream indicates -40°C (-40°F).
      • If there is a short circuit, the Techstream indicates higher than 166°C (331°F).

    Result:  2

    See step  4

    Result:  3

    CHECK FOR INTERMITTENT PROBLEMS:  CHECK FOR INTERMITTENT PROBLEMS [08/2013 - ] 

    Result:  1

    See step  2

  2. READ VALUE USING TECHSTREAM (CHECK FOR OPEN IN WIRE HARNESS) 
    1. Disconnect the engine oil temperature sensor connector.

    2. Connect terminals 1 and 2 of the engine oil temperature sensor connector on the wire harness side.
    3. Connect the Techstream to the DLC3.
    4. Turn the ignition switch to ON.
    5. Turn the Techstream on.
    6. Enter the following menus: Powertrain / Engine and ECT / Data List / Engine Control / Engine Oil Temperature Sensor.

      Powertrain > Engine and ECT > Data List 

      Tester Display
      Engine Oil Temperature Sensor
    7. Read the value displayed on the Techstream.

      Standard Value

      Higher than 166°C (331°F)

      Result

      Proceed to
      OK
      NG

    Result:  1

    OK 

    REPLACE ENGINE OIL TEMPERATURE SENSOR:  REMOVAL [08/2013 - ] 

    Result:  2

    NG 

    See step  3

  3. CHECK HARNESS AND CONNECTOR (ENGINE OIL TEMPERATURE SENSOR - ECM) 
    1. Disconnect the engine oil temperature sensor connector.
    2. Disconnect the ECM connector.
    3. Measure the resistance according to the value(s) in the table below.

      Standard Resistance

      Tester Connection Condition Specified Condition
      B38-2 - B33-131 (THEO) Always Below 1 Ω
      B38-1 - B33-132 (ETHE) Always Below 1 Ω

      Result

      Proceed to
      OK
      NG

    Result:  1

    OK 

    REPLACE ECM:  REMOVAL [08/2013 - 08/2016] 

    Result:  2

    NG 

    REPAIR OR REPLACE HARNESS OR CONNECTOR 

  4. READ VALUE USING TECHSTREAM (CHECK FOR SHORT IN WIRE HARNESS) 
    1. Disconnect the engine oil temperature sensor connector.

    2. Connect the Techstream to the DLC3.
    3. Turn the ignition switch to ON.
    4. Turn the Techstream on.
    5. Enter the following menus: Powertrain / Engine and ECT / Data List / Engine Control / Engine Oil Temperature Sensor.

      Powertrain > Engine and ECT > Data List 

      Tester Display
      Engine Oil Temperature Sensor
    6. Read the value displayed on the Techstream.

      Standard Value

      -40°C (-40°F)

      Result

      Proceed to
      OK
      NG

    Result:  1

    OK 

    REPLACE ENGINE OIL TEMPERATURE SENSOR:  REMOVAL [08/2013 - ] 

    Result:  2

    NG 

    See step  5

  5. CHECK HARNESS AND CONNECTOR (ENGINE OIL TEMPERATURE SENSOR - ECM) 
    1. Disconnect the engine oil temperature sensor connector.
    2. Disconnect the ECM connector.
    3. Measure the resistance according to the value(s) in the table below.

      Standard Resistance

      Tester Connection Condition Specified Condition
      B33-131 (THEO) or B38-2 - Body ground Always 10 kΩ or higher

      Result

      Proceed to
      OK
      NG

    Result:  1

    OK 

    REPLACE ECM:  REMOVAL [08/2013 - 08/2016] 

    Result:  2

    NG 

    REPAIR OR REPLACE HARNESS OR CONNECTOR
